Nawazuddin Siddiqui reveals he enjoys playing light-hearted characters

His upcoming romantic comedy film Jogira Sara Ra Ra is directed by Kushan Nandy

Nawazuddin Siddiqui will be next seen in the romantic comedy film Jogira Sara Ra Ra, which is set to release on May 12. Meanwhile, he said, "While my fans love to see me playing dark characters, I enjoy being in the light. And I am confident that this time even they will enjoy the laughs with this oddball couple who are determined to not lose their hearts to each other come what may. It's an original and refreshing subject, like a hawa ka jhonka."

Nawazuddin is reuniting with Babumoshai Bandookbaaz (2017) director Kushan Nandy for the film. Jogira Sara Ra Ra also stars Neha Sharma. The recently released teaser introduces Nawaz as Jogi Pratap whose ‘jugaad’ never fails. We also see Neha as a bride, sitting on a horse. Subsequently, Nawaz is seen running off with a woman on his shoulders. A lot seems to go wrong and Neha eventually tells Nawaz that all his ‘jugaad’ has failed.

The film is produced by Naeem A Siddiqui, with Kiran Shyam Shroff as the creative producer. It also stars Zarina Wahab, Sanjay Mishra and Mahakshay Chakraborty in pivotal roles.
